CX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

301 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cemex (CX)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$3.83B — up 14% from $3.35B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new CX posit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 94 added to existing stakes and 118 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Samlyn Capital, opening a new position worth an estimated $59.1M. The largest seller was Schroder Investment Management Group, cutting an estimated $50.6M.
